Saudi, Turkey, Pakistan pact comes amid US-Iran war fallout
Saudi Arabia, Pakistan and Turkey signed a mutual defence pact on Friday that would treat any act of aggression on one of the three nations as an attack on all of them, the allies said in a joint statement. Saudi Arabia, Turkiye and Pakistan have signed a key defence agreement
The agreement between the three Sunni Muslim-majority states brings together oil-rich Saudi Arabia and nuclear power Pakistan as well as Turkey, which has NATO’s second-largest army and a rapidly growing defence industry.
